版权声明:添加我的微信wlagooble,开启一段不一样的旅程 https://blog.csdn.net/nineship/article/details/89478683
import os
import shutil
from time import sleep
def copyCopy(usb_path):
# os.listdir(dir)返回dir下所有文件夹及文件的名称
usb_file = os.listdir(usb_path)
while True:
new_usb_file = os.lisdir(usb_path)
if new_usb_file != usb_file:
break
sleep(5) #每隔5s扫描一次
file = [f for f in new_usb_file if f not in usb_file]
shutil.copytree(os.path.join(usb_path, file[0]), '/home/work/copyCopy')
if __name__ == "__main__":
usb_path = "/Volumes/"
copyCopy(usb_path)
参考:https://blog.csdn.net/qq_28168421/article/details/89464852